With a park-like setting in one of the most sought after locations in the Metroplex between Bartonville and Argyle, this beautiful 41-acre property, with scattered mature oaks, a creek that meanders through a grove of trees, a nice pond and a large coastal Bermuda pasture, offers 2 homes with several fantastic sites around the property if you would rather build, a 4,500 square foot shop and a livestock/equipment barn. Located at the northeast corner of the property, the 2,500+ square foot main home was built in the early 1970s. It has an inviting charm with multiple living areas, 4 bedrooms, 3 full baths and a 2-car garage. Nearby is a detached 3-car garage and a 50x90 fully insulated, open span steel framed building with two 14x14 overhead doors and 50-amp electric service for RV storage. Theres also a small block shop and a 36x72 livestock/equipment pole barn that at one time was used for horses, although the stalls have been removed. The second home is located a good distance from the main home at the southeast corner of the property. It was built in the late 1970s and offers over 2,700 square feet of living space, 2 living areas, 4 bedrooms and 3 full baths and is currently leased. The land is truly gorgeous. From the gated entrance and scattered mature oak trees at the front, the property has a very gentle slope to a grove of trees and a meandering creek about half way in. From the grove westward is a large, Bermuda hay pasture and a nice stock pond. The soil in this area is a sandy loam, there is a current agricultural exemption in place and 50% of the minerals will convey with the sale.
